Sea Kayaking is a safe and fun activity enabling you to journey through new areas and explore coastlines and habitats. All our sea kayaks are long, stable and easy to control and to paddle in a straight line.
The Forth estuary is rich in wildlife and you may be lucky enough to encounter seals, dolphins, porpoise, a huge variety of coastal birds or perhaps even a whale.
